A stitch in time for Rasen church

Hours of work and thousands of stitches have gone in to create a new altar frontal for the Lady Chapel at St Thomas's Church in Market Rasen.

Seasoned needleworker Sheena Cook led the team, with the help of husband Christopher, who cut everything out.

An amazing 97,000 machine embroidery stitches are included in each panel, taking more than five hours work for each panel.

The frontal completes the chapel’s refurbishment.
